2 day long Unakoti festival will start from January 14th
PHOTO : Unakoti. TIWN Pic

Agartala, January 12 (TIWN): Two day long Unakoti festival will start from January 14th this month. The festival will be inaugurated by the Sabhadipati of Unakoti Zilla Parishad, Kalpana DEbnath. MLA Birajit Sinha, DM of Unakoti, Police Super Lalria Darlong will present in the dias as Guest of Honour. While MLA Samiran Malakar will preside over the function. Every year, on the basis of Makar Sankranti, Unakoti festival and fair were organized.

Like previous years this year also, Makar Sankranti Mela will be organized at Unakoti at 14th January.

To mark the occasion, a preparatory meeting was held under the leadership of Sub­ Divisional District Magistrate, Ajit Sukla Das.The committee had taken valuable decision to make the fair a beautiful and splendid one.

Pous Sankranti Mela, or Makar sankranti mela is one of the exquisite fairs held every year at Tripura.

It comes along with a festive mood to impart fervor and attachment amongst the people of Tripura with the rest of the world. Pous Sankranti Mela is celebrated with maximum zeal and enthusiasm at Tripura and is visited by most people of the country. A holy dip in the River Gomati, on this occasion, is believed to wash away earthly sins. People also perform Shradh, Tarpan and Pinda Daan rituals dedicated to the dead forefathers on the day. Known as Pongal in Tamil Nadu and Maghi in Punjab, Makar Sankranti is celebrated with much vigor in different parts of the country.
